Основы HTML и CSS: создание простого веб-сайта

Основы HTML и CSS: создание простого веб-сайта

Создание веб-сайта, даже самого простого, начинается с изучения HTML и CSS. Эти технологии позволяют структурировать и стилизовать содержимое страниц. HTML (HyperText Markup Language) отвечает за структуру веб-страницы, задавая расположение текстов, изображений и других элементов. CSS (Cascading Style Sheets) используется для придания стилевого оформления, определяя шрифты, цвета, отступы и многое другое. В этом обзоре мы рассмотрим различные подходы к созданию веб-сайта, оценим плюсы и минусы технологий и предоставим рекомендации по выбору инструментов.

Сравнение подходов к созданию сайтов

Существует несколько подходов к созданию веб-сайтов, начиная от ручного кодирования и заканчивая использованием различных фреймворков и CMS (систем управления контентом). Ручное кодирование на HTML и CSS дает полную свободу в дизайне, что особенно важно для уникальных проектов. Однако, этот подход требует больше времени и глубоких знаний в области веб-разработки. С другой стороны, использование CMS, таких как WordPress, позволяет создавать сайты быстрее, но с определенными ограничениями в дизайне и функционале.

Плюсы и минусы технологий

HTML и CSS, будучи основными инструментами веб-разработчика, имеют свои достоинства и недостатки. Главный плюс HTML и CSS — это их универсальность и поддержка всеми браузерами. Они позволяют создать сайт с нуля и полностью контролировать его внешний вид и структуру. Однако, для сложных проектов, этих технологий может быть недостаточно. В таких случаях приходится дополнительно изучать JavaScript или использовать более сложные фреймворки. Недостатком может стать и необходимость кроссбраузерного тестирования, так как некоторые стили могут отображаться по-разному в различных браузерах.

Рекомендации по выбору

Выбор подхода и инструментов для создания веб-сайта зависит от целей проекта и уровня подготовки разработчика. Новичкам стоит начать с изучения основ HTML и CSS, чтобы получить понимание о том, как устроены веб-страницы. Это знание станет крепкой основой для дальнейшего изучения более сложных технологий. Для небольших и средних проектов, особенно если сроки ограничены, может быть целесообразным использование CMS с готовыми шаблонами. Однако, для уникальных проектов и более полной кастомизации, ручное кодирование станет лучшим выбором.

Актуальные тенденции 2024

В 2024 году мы наблюдаем усиление трендов на адаптивный дизайн и минимализм. Сайты становятся более интуитивно понятными и быстрыми за счет оптимизации кода и использования новых возможностей CSS, таких как Flexbox и Grid. Все больше разработчиков ориентируются на мобильные устройства, создавая так называемые «mobile-first» дизайны. Популярность набирают технологии, упрощающие разработку, такие как CSS-препроцессоры (например, SASS) и фреймворки (Bootstrap). Они позволяют ускорить процесс создания сайта, сохраняя при этом высокое качество кода.

Таким образом, изучение HTML и CSS остается актуальным и в 2024 году, но успех в веб-разработке требует постоянного обучения и следования современным трендам.

3
2
Прокрутить вверх